Sash windows Sash windows make a great option for older homes. They are classic and durable. They are also extremely secure and allow for good ventilation. However, they may require more care than other kinds of windows. They can become jammed with time due to the weight of the sash. This is why it's important to know what you need to be looking for to keep them in good working order. Draught-proofing is a good way to ensure that your sash window is in good condition. This is a great thing to do as it will keep cold air out and help your energy costs. Double glazing is another alternative. This will boost the efficiency of your window and cut your heating bills by up to 40%.. In recent times, many homeowners have replaced their windows with double-glazed. The main reason is that they are looking to improve the efficiency of their homes. This can be a problem for older properties. Certain aspects must be considered for example, the delicate design of a shash when replacing single panes of glass with double glazing. Some firms specialize in sash window installation and offer suggestions on how to improve the energy efficiency of your home. You can also seek help with other services like installing new locks and handles. They also have a range of glass options to suit your needs. These services can be expensive, but they're worth it. Sash windows are available in a variety of sizes and styles. Some are fixed, while others slide up and down. They can be made of wood or uPVC. Timber sash windows have traditionally been more expensive, however they also have a timeless look which is difficult to duplicate using uPVC. Sash windows made of wood are extremely durable and an excellent insulation. They can last for a long time if they are maintained correctly. Sliding doors Modern homes are increasingly using sliding doors, thanks to their sleek design and versatility. They provide easy access to outdoor spaces, boost the amount of natural light and make rooms more spacious. They can also be used as emergency escapes. These doors come in a wide range of styles and colors, therefore they are suitable for any home. A sliding door consists of two or more glass panels that open on tracks. The panels are typically framed and attached in a parallel fashion. Historically, these doors were only one-panel doors; however the recent rise in popularity and coverage in shelter magazines has resulted in the introduction of multi-panel sliding doors. These doors use multiple parallel rails that transport six to twelve sliding panels into wall pockets on either side of the opening. These doors are typically operated with remote controls. Large sliding doors that have large glass panels let a lot of natural light to come into the home. This can lower your energy bills by reducing the need for artificial lighting. Additionally, the natural light will brighten your space and make it appear more welcoming and welcoming. Sliding doors look attractive and practical for homes of all sizes. They also offer a great sourcing service for hard-to-find doors and window replacements. Window frames The window frames are a crucial part of any home. They shield against drafts, pests, and the elements. They can also add style and elegance to the exterior of a house. There are many different types of frame materials you can pick from, each with its own pros and cons. It is crucial to know about the various options before selecting the right frame for your home. Window frame materials differ in price, durability and energy efficiency. They can be made from aluminium, wood, uPVC, or fiberglass. Certain materials are more durable than others, but the frame's overall performance will depend on your personal needs and budget. Wood frames are popular because of their attractiveness and durability. They also help conserve energy. Vinyl frames are also popular due to the fact that they're affordable and easy to maintain. They are available in a range of colors and are used to create a broad variety of designs. However, they don't offer the same degree of insulation as wood or aluminum frames. Composite windows are an alternative that offer natural-looking appearance while offering high insulation and resistance to moisture. They are typically comprised of materials that are mingled together in the manufacturing process. They're also an environmentally friendly alternative to traditional wooden windows and are more affordable than vinyl or aluminum. The sash is the component of the window that is moved when you open and close the glass. It is comprised of a set of vertical and horizontal window components, referred to as rails and stiles. The stiles are vertical parts of the sash, and the rails sit between them. A window might also have muntins. They are small grids that are used for functional or decorative design.
